According to DIN 45511 the frequency has been from 30Hz to 15KHz +/- 3db with CRo² tape.
The twin has been the 165 (with autoreverse) which I had that time.
Actually that would be at -20 dB, but that's ok... :thmbsp:Keep in mind that cassette deck freq responses were always spec'd at -30 dB. At 0 dB, most of them couldn't break 7000 Hz.
It always depends on how you measure, At least the DIN-method has been finally the highest standard that time to fulfill.Keep in mind that cassette deck freq responses were always spec'd at -30 dB. At 0 dB, most of them couldn't break 7000 Hz.
